WebThe as.POSIX* functions convert an object to one of the two classes used to represent date/times (calendar dates plus time to the nearest second). They can convert objects of the other class and of class "Date" to these classes. Dates without times are treated as being at midnight UTC. WebCompare to base R. These are drop in replacements for as.Date() and as.POSIXct(), with a few tweaks to make them work more intuitively.. Called on a POSIXct object, as_date() uses the tzone attribute of the object to return the same date as indicated by the printed representation of the object. This differs from as.Date, which ignores the attribute and … WebMay 23, 2024 · A timestamp object can be converted to a POSIXct object, using them as.POSIXct (date) method in R. as.POSIXct (timestamp, origin = "1970-01-01") This is followed by the application of as.Date method over the POSIXct object. WebDec 5, 2024 · You can use various functions from the lubridate package in R to convert a character column to a date format. Two of the most common functions include: ymd () – Convert character in year-month-date format to date. mdy () – Convert character in month-day-year format to date.
